West Maui Mountain Waterfall and Ocean Tour via Horseback

Overview
Maui Mountain Activities offers horseback rides that take you up into the West Maui Mountains to view waterfalls (seasonal) from a distance, then down to the coastline to ride alongside the Pacific Ocean.  Experience the tranquility of Maui's native rainforests and the beauty of its waters.  There is a run spot where you can run your horse, if you want (weather permitting), and your guides will take photos of you with your camera along the way.  Tour through the petting zoo and experience up close the many animals, which may include mini horses, geese, rabbits, guinea pigs, pigs, and sheep.  This is a 2 hour tour.  Soft drinks are provided and complimentary.

What's Included
Saddle bags and helmets are provided
All activities will be guided
Refreshments (soda, juice, water) will be available and complimentary.
Additional Info
  • Not recommended for travelers with spinal injuries
  • Not recommended for pregnant travelers
  • Not recommended for travelers with poor cardiovascular health
  • Travelers should have at least a moderate level of physical fitness
  • Long pants, closed toe shoes, sunscreen, and a camera are recommended
  • Minimum age of 7yrs
  • Weight limit of 230lbs (104.54kg) Strictly Enforced
  • ACCURATE body weights are mandatory. If you exceed the body weight given to us by 15 pounds, we will try to see if there is a horse that can accommodate you. If we do not have a horse to accommodate you, you will be unable to ride and will not be refunded.
  • All Maui County rules and regulations are followed. No masks required.
Cancellation Policy
For a full refund, cancel at least 24 hours before the scheduled departure time.

My husband and I made this part of our 5-year anniversary trip. We did the afternoon ride (which is one of the last afternoons they will be doing they mentioned). It was fun - just the 2 of us and our guide. We were on the horses for a little over an hour and got to cross the street and ride through the brush to the edge of the mountain overlooking the beautiful cliffs and clear blue water. We went in mid-August and the weather was perfect. This company is all family run and operated and they each run different sections of the ranch. Next time, we will try the ATVs. The horses are well taken care of and bathed/fed after every ride. You don't need to take much with you, as you will be holding on to the reigns the whole time. We were very sore the next day and had an 8 hour flight back to the mainland, so we don't recommend riding the day before your flight - makes for a long and uncomfortable plane ride! haha. But we highly recommend this place for the staff and the adventure.

Stacy, Kristin, (not sure of spelling), AJ and Nick make up a great group of people running a first rate business. Stacy and Kristin take good care of getting you up to the stables and mounted up for the ride. Nick and AJ are great train guides. They work with riders of all experience to make sure you have a wonderful ride. Unlike many trail rides there were a couple opportunities to run the horses, if you wanted to. The second time we ran them, a couple of riders did not feel up to it. No problem, Nick kept them back and brought them along a at pace they felt comfortable. The morning ride is a long ride which makes it a great value, especially when you factor in the views and the staff. A nice touch is having some small saddle bags that you can put soft drinks, juice or water (provided) to have on the trail. NOTE: Some people have had trouble finding the parking lot where you transfer to a van to get to the stables because GPS links seem be be faulty. If you book enough in advance, you will be sent an email with a link that seems to work fine. The parking lot is on the LEFT side coming from Kahalui, regardless of what your GPS says. Kristin says they are trying to get Google to correct the issue.
